The dominant view of globalisation is that it is good for everyone. Globalists such as Financial Times` Wolf, World Bank economists Dollar and Kraay claim that globalisation has reduced poverty and inequality and has promoted economic growth across the globe. Meanwhile, among many critics of globalisation, Wade argues that the dominant view ignores negative effects of globalisation and it relies on arbitrary data from the World Bank and the IMF. Along with the debate about the benefits of globalisation for the poor, there are also many ongoing discussions as to whether globalisation is a process or a theory, and it is a new or an old concept.
